What is a Shipping Container?
A shipping container is a large standardized steel box designed for carrying products. These containers are built to stand up to extreme weather conditions and misuse during shipping, making them robust storage solutions for numerous applications. They can be found in different sizes and types, supplying versatility for various requirements.

When thinking about leasing a shipping container, it's necessary to comprehend the costs involved. Below is a general breakdown of what you may anticipate to pay:
Type of ContainerSizeMonth-to-month Rental Cost (Approx.)Additional CostsBasic20ft₤ 100 - ₤ 200Delivery fees, pickup charges, and maintenanceStandard40ft₤ 150 - ₤ 300Delivery costs, pickup fees, and upkeepHigh Cube20ft₤ 120 - ₤ 220Delivery fees, pickup fees, and maintenanceHigh Cube40ft₤ 180 - ₤ 350Delivery fees, pickup fees, and upkeep
Keep in mind: Prices might vary based on area, condition of the container (new or used), and period of rental.
